Troubleshooting and Installation

To troubleshoot issues with your Gmail mobile signature image, keep in mind that you can only add an image to your signature from a computer, not from the mobile app.

If you receive a "The signature is too long" error, try reverting font changes, removing extra links or images, or adjusting text alignment to reduce length.

To successfully install your Gmail signature, add hyperlinks to social media icons, product links, or buttons by highlighting the field and clicking the link icon, and then scroll down and click Save Changes.

Credit: youtube.com, Gmail Signature Issues On Mobile? - TheEmailToolbox.com

Here are some steps to follow when adding an image to your signature:

  1. Open Settings in Gmail and go to your Signature section. Then, click on Create New.
  2. In the right box, hit the Insert Image icon from the toolbar to add a picture to your signature.
  3. In the Add an image window, you can add images from multiple locations: Google Drive, your computer using Upload, and Web Address. Choose your preferred option and click on Select.
  4. Modify the size of the image and hyperlink your signature image. Finally, scroll down and hit the Save changes button.

To get the correct image in your email signature, make sure you're using the correct link. This is often a common mistake, where users add the wrong link.

Top view white mock up business card with copy space placed on modern opened netbook on round marble table in light room
Credit: pexels.com, Top view white mock up business card with copy space placed on modern opened netbook on round marble table in light room

You need to add the image address, not the link to the page containing the image. This might seem like a small difference, but it makes a big impact.

To get the correct URL for your image, right-click on the image and select Copy image address. This will give you the exact link you need.

Paste the copied address from any two methods in the URL section of Gmail Signature's Add image window.
